Aztec clothing. this woman is wearing a skirt, a blouse, and an ear plug. this man is wearing a cape, a loincloth and an ear plug. aztec clothing was worn by the aztec people and varied according to aspects such as social standing and gender. the garments worn by aztecs were also worn by other pre columbian peoples of central mexico who shared.

The status of aztec women has changed throughout the history of the civilization. in the early days of the aztecs, before they settled in tenochtitlan, women owned property and had roughly equal legal and economic rights. as an emphasis on warfare increased, so too did ideas of male dominance. women did not participate in warfare except as. Aztec jewellery and ornaments. the aztecs projected wealth by wearing extensive jewellery often made of gold or precious stones. headdresses often made of feathers were also considered to be very beautiful. feathers, gold, fur, necklaces, bangles, earrings, nose rings and even lip rings were worn. they become much more elaborate in some costumes.
